Unconventional Christmas Vision BoardsWhen the holiday season approaches, traditional decorating often focuses on nostalgia, reds, greens, and classic scenes. However, creating a Christmas vision board doesn’t have to follow the standard, curated aesthetic. A quirky vision board serves as a creative anchor for the festive season, setting intentions for, say, a chaotic, laughter-filled holiday rather than a perfectly staged one. These unconventional boards act as a visual manifestation of the joy, humor, and unique experiences you want to curate, breaking away from the Pinterest-perfect mold.
The Vintage Kitsch and Retro Christmas VibeOne of the most engaging and quirky approaches is a deep dive into retro kitsch. Imagine a vision board filled with 1950s aluminum tree ads, pastel-colored ornament cutouts, and pictures of kitschy ceramic deer. The aesthetic embraces bright, non-traditional colors like aqua blue, bright pink, and sunny yellow, combined with the classic sparkle of tinsel. To create this, scour old magazines or print images of retro decorations, vintage carolers, and eccentric holiday fashion. The goal is to evoke a fun, nostalgic, and slightly ironic mood that makes you smile every time you look at it. Add in cutouts of retro cocktail recipes, like eggnog with a twist, to emphasize the festive party aspect of your vision.
The Festive Foodie BoardFor many, Christmas is synonymous with comfort food, making a foodie-themed vision board a delicious idea. Instead of just focusing on decorations, this board centers entirely on the culinary delights you intend to create or devour. Include photos of experimental hot cocoa bars, intricate gingerbread houses, ridiculous holiday cookies, and festive cocktails. Add in snippets of recipes you want to try, or photos of non-traditional Christmas dinners like a holiday sushi spread or a taco party. A foodie board can also include pictures of vintage recipe cards and colorful food packaging, adding a tactile element. It’s an inspiring way to map out your festive cravings and ensure your season is full of, perhaps not traditionally healthy, but certainly joyous, delicious memories.
A Sustainable and “Trash-to-Treasure” BoardA quirky, creative, and eco-friendly vision board focuses on upcycling and sustainability, proving that holiday cheer doesn’t have to come in plastic packaging. This board features ideas for DIY decorations made from old clothing, pinecones gathered in the neighborhood, and vintage, refurbished baubles. Use materials like twine, felt scraps, and newspaper for the board’s decoration itself. Include images of handmade gift wrapping using brown paper and dried orange slices, or decorations crafted from recycled wine corks. It’s a whimsical, charming approach that champions creativity, encouraging you to rethink what constitutes a “perfect” decoration and finding beauty in the unconventional and eco-conscious.
The “Chaos Comfort” Holiday VibeSometimes the best Christmas plans involve absolutely no plans at all. A “Chaos Comfort” board is for those who want to focus on rest, relaxation, and cozy, quiet moments rather than hosting huge parties. This board could feature pictures of oversized, comfy sweaters, mismatched fuzzy socks, overflowing mugs of hot chocolate, and stacks of classic Christmas books or movies. Add cutouts of fairy lights, candles, and scenes of snowy, peaceful nature. It’s an intentional visual reminder to slow down, embrace the cozy atmosphere, and prioritize your own comfort. This board might be characterized by warm, soft textures, and muted, relaxing colors, creating a soothing sanctuary on your wall.
The Eccentric Holiday Pop Culture BoardFor lovers of humor and pop culture, a board dedicated to the quirkier side of holiday media is a fantastic option. Think scenes from cult-classic Christmas movies, funny holiday memes, and pictures of famous, slightly surreal holiday decorations from around the world. Include cutouts of unconventional characters, like the Grinch, or iconic, funny scenes from “Christmas Vacation.” This board isn’t about perfectly curated aesthetic beauty, but rather, it’s about celebrating the humorous, sometimes bizarre side of the festive season. It’s a joyful, irreverent take that brings a sense of fun and lightheartedness to your holiday planning, making you laugh and setting a relaxed, joyful tone.
